Ends a property section (an inner property stream).
Namespace:  Microsoft.VisualStudio.Shell.Interop
Assembly:  Microsoft.VisualStudio.Shell.Interop (in Microsoft.VisualStudio.Shell.Interop.dll)

Parameters
- dwCookie
 Type: System.UInt32
 [in] Pointer to an integer that is a cookie identifying the property section to end. Cookie comes from the BeginPropertySection call.
Return Value
Type: System.Int32
If the method succeeds, it returns S_OK. If it fails, it returns an error code.
Implements
IVsPropertyStreamOut.EndPropertySection(UInt32)
Remarks
Call the Flush method after calling EndPropertySection and continuing with an outer property stream.
